Transaction 1525ff062e7267c9c606307dcea1a31c56612b6bac3aeeca284ccf6b94c1216a

1 Input
2 Outputs
  • 1525ff062e7267c9c606307dcea1a31c56612b6bac3aeeca284ccf6b94c1216a:0
  • value  20166186
    address  3DYnXARjbFSwKD6PzvNbKPpXo5rQt94eWx
  • 1525ff062e7267c9c606307dcea1a31c56612b6bac3aeeca284ccf6b94c1216a:1
  • value  46144
    address  3CAoWEYe3HzzXxFJ7mNmCyyHuqTLXBStcx